Esra from Turkey: How to spend 48 hours in Belgrade?

A View on Belgrade Q&A
Also available:  Srpski latinica (Srbija) 
Published: 14 December 2020
Read Time: 1 min
Hits: 2812

Our friend, Esra, from Samsun, in Turkey, recommends what to do and see in Belgrade if you only have 48 hours.
